In 2009, I graduated with a degree in Publishing Studies from Hofstra University. It is really hard to get a job right now, and it seems even harder in the publishing industry. I am currently working as a proofreader for a pharmaceutical company, but would like to keep working with books of any and all genres. I have interned for Hachette Book Group and Writers House
At Writers House, I read query letters, partial manuscripts, and full manuscripts that were sent to the general submissions and also ones sent to a specific agent. I commented on all materials received and sent a recommendation to the agent's assistant whether we should reject or ask to see more. I also wrote full reports for the assistant. After reading full manuscripts, I wrote editorial letters to suggest changes the author could make to make the novel more suitable for that agent.
